Transaction 0885c7ad105b1193220645ab4febe2072496fb0d284ae188ce716caee383de76
3 Input
2 Outputs
- 0885c7ad105b1193220645ab4febe2072496fb0d284ae188ce716caee383de76:0
- 0885c7ad105b1193220645ab4febe2072496fb0d284ae188ce716caee383de76:1
value 6690000
address 1AmXvFVEDPgddgfmPzwRpo6jMaXxCxtuG1
value 1185496
address 1KRpLEzMNocd1DEnFsvtLfhqWnzFs7hqCp